摘  要:Chinese materia medica(CMM) compatibility is one core content in the theory of Traditional Chinese Medicine(TCM), and elaborating the scientific connotation of CMM compatibility is of great significance to promote the modernization of TCM. Self-assembly is the combination of active ingredients into aggregates through noncovalent bonds, such as hydrogen bonding, electrostatic interactions, ionic interactions, and hydrophobic interactions. The complex properties and special structures of CMM components create the basis for selfassembly. The self-assembled materials formed after CMM compatibility is an important part of the material basis for the efficacy of TCM, which can help explain the scientific connotations of CMM compatibility. This review summarizes the self-assembly phenomenon from the perspective of drug pair combinations in recent decades and explains the scientific connotation of CMM compatibility about the material basis, pharmacodynamic changes, and mechanism of action, providing new ideas and methods for the study of TCM.
